Ticket Sales Phases and Priorities

Understanding the ticket sales process is crucial to maximizing your chances of getting your hands on those golden tickets. Most clubs, including Union Berlin and Bayer Leverkusen, follow a phased approach, prioritizing different groups of fans.

  • Season Ticket Holders: Season ticket holders are usually guaranteed access to all home matches. Their seats are reserved, and they don't need to participate in the general ticket sales.
  • Club Members: Club members typically get priority access to ticket sales before the general public. This is a significant advantage, especially for high-demand matches. Membership tiers may influence the order in which members can purchase tickets.
  • General Public: After season ticket holders and club members have had their chance, any remaining tickets are usually released to the general public. This is the most competitive phase, and tickets often sell out within minutes.

Getting to the Stadium

Okay, so you've got your tickets! Now, how do you actually get to the stadium? Let's break down the transportation options for both Union Berlin's Stadion An der Alten Försterei and Bayer Leverkusen's BayArena.

Stadion An der Alten Försterei (Union Berlin):

  • Public Transportation: The most convenient way to reach the stadium is by public transport. Take the S-Bahn (S3, S9) to Köpenick station. From there, it's about a 15-20 minute walk to the stadium. Follow the signs and the throngs of fellow fans.
  • Tram: Tram lines 60, 61, 62, 63, and 67 also stop near the stadium. Check the BVG (Berlin public transport) website for the most up-to-date schedules and routes.
  • Bus: Several bus lines serve the area around the stadium. Again, consult the BVG website for specific routes and timings.
  • Car: Driving to the stadium is not recommended due to limited parking and heavy traffic on match days. If you must drive, arrive early and be prepared to park some distance away and walk.
